With Opened Eyes



I stepped onto my beaten porch,
the grass still wet with dew,
the sun unwilling to shine past
 the clouds, the view was nothing new.
In the cold Spring morning I walked,
anxious to perform my routine
and was stopped by a mangy cat
with eyes a dull, burnt-out green,
without a word, without a cry,
the animal shuffled ‘round my feet,
looking upon me with those dim eyes,
full of hope for anything but defeat,
and, as I had done every day,
I drove the cat to flee,
“Go away,” I always said,
my words a begging plea.
While walking to my car
followed by my younger sister,
she looked over at me,
her words but a whisper,
“Let’s go somewhere new,
school can always wait.”
I drew a breath,
ready to shatter her bait,
and looked at her green eyes,
full of joy and passion.
At once I knew, that one hour
was far less than I could ration.
